Biomedical research activities at King’s College London are coordinated and integrated through Research Divisions across all of our Health Schools and campuses. Research strengths in the School of Biomedical Sciences include: developmental neurobiology; biophysics and cell biology; human physiological function and adaptation in health and disease; the mechanisms of ageing and intervention strategies to ameliorate the ageing process; drug discovery, delivery and mode of action and detection; the relationship between environment and health; and analytical sciences.
Our research excellence is well recognised – many of our research groups were top rated in the last HEFCE Research Assessment Exercise. The School hosts two prestigious MRC centres in Environment & Health and Developmental Neurobiology.
